How the governance actually works

Every one of these is a product behaviour you can demonstrate, not a promise in a contract.

Permission inheritanceAI Assistant
The assistant operates strictly inside the permissions of the person asking. It cannot read a project you cannot read.
Confirmation stepAI Assistant
In the app, an action that changes data shows you what will happen before it runs. Over a connected MCP host there is no such step — a write tool executes when called.
Pending AI actionsAI Assistant
Action types can be held for a human to approve before they execute.
Supported hostsMCP Server
Claude, ChatGPT, Cursor and other MCP-compatible hosts, with per-platform setup walkthroughs.
Connection limitsMCP Server
Each connection has defined access and limits, and can be reviewed or revoked at any time.
Report reviewAI Client Reporter
Drafts are reviewed before they reach a client — the reporter proposes, a person sends.
Call and action logsActivity log
MCP calls and AI actions are recorded against the workspace with full context.

Common questions

Can the assistant see things a user should not?

No. It operates inside the permissions of the person asking. If you cannot open a project, neither can the assistant on your behalf.

Will it change data without being asked?

In the app, no — an action that changes data shows you what will happen before it runs. Over a connected MCP host it can: a write tool executes the moment it is called, with no confirmation prompt. That is why connections default to read-only, and why you should only grant write access to a host that genuinely needs it.

Which AI hosts can connect over MCP?

Claude, ChatGPT, Cursor and other MCP-compatible hosts. Each has its own setup walkthrough, and every connection can be reviewed or revoked from settings.

How is AI usage billed?

Usage draws on workspace AI credits. Consumption is visible in the workspace, so spend is something you can watch rather than discover.
